titleOfInvention |
Shaped catalyst body in the form of tetralobes of uniform wall thickness |
abstract |
The invention relates to a shaped catalyst body in the form of a tetralobe having four circular through-passages, with the midpoints of the through-passages forming a square and the spacings between in each case two adjacent through-passages being from 0.8 to 1.2 times the thickness of the outer walls of the through-passages. The shaped catalyst body is used for the oxidation of S02 to S03. |
